Cannot run API test from test complete

I have setup a 'ReadyAPI' item in test complete. When I try to execute it I am getting the below. I dont know enough to work out what is wrong. Project file is specified in test complete. Any help in debugging is appreciated.

 

 

cmd.exe /C testrunner.bat  "-sAutomationTestData" "-cCreateRoles" -I -r -j -a "-fC:\Users\SNEJAD~1.BIO\AppData\Local\Temp\{AFCB2334-9706-4BB8-956D-3D26E47924ED}" "-PstartRow=81" "-PendRow=81" "-PPCName=PC417026" "-PprojectPath=C:\Connect\EnterpriseAutomatedTests\RegressionTests\" "C:\Connect\EnterpriseAutomatedTests\RegressionTests\Files\OCDAutomationTests\OrthoReadyAPIProject\OrthoAPITestData.xml"

No project file is specified.

The test runner has exited with code 1.
 
 
 
endorium_0-1627293394564.png

 

 

 

Bit more information. It seems to be the parameter 'projectPath' I am tryign to send in thats causing the issue. I remove this and it runs (but fails). Seems to be using this parameter to find the project file. This seems to be a genuine bug?

 

 

testrunner.bat "-sAutomationTestData" "-cCreateRule" -I -r -j -a "-fC:\Users\SNEJAD~1.BIO\AppData\Local\Temp\{04199B9B-52A6-441D-87DD-A29916BCA941}" "-PstartRow=81" "-PendRow=81" "-PPCName=PC417026" "-PprojectPath=C:\Connect\EnterpriseAutomatedTests\RegressionTests\" "C:\Connect\EnterpriseAutomatedTests\RegressionTests\Files\OCDAutomationTests\OrthoReadyAPIProject\OrthoAPITestData.xml"
